About Forest Green

Forest Green is a small village located in Surrey, England, within the RH5 postcode area. It is surrounded by the natural beauty of the Surrey Hills, making it a pleasant spot for those who enjoy outdoor activities. The village features a mix of residential homes and local amenities, including a few shops and a pub where residents and visitors can gather.

The area is well-connected by road, making it accessible for those travelling to nearby towns and cities. Forest Green is also close to several walking trails and nature reserves, offering opportunities for leisurely strolls and enjoying the countryside. The community is friendly and welcoming, providing a sense of belonging for both locals and newcomers alike.

Household Income in Forest Green ONS 2023

The average total household income in Forest Green is approximately £69,679 a year before tax, 26% above the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£49,381.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Forest Green ONS 2025

There are approximately 1,074 active businesses based in Forest Green, around 71 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 92%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 5 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Forest Green

Of the 6,471 households in and around Forest Green, 74% are owned, 11% are socially rented and 14%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
